Anupam Rajan, born on November 1, 1968, is a 1993 batch IAS officer of the Madhya Pradesh cadre. He holds M.A. degrees in Sociology and another discipline from Jawaharlal Nehru University, New Delhi. Currently serving as Additional Chief Secretary (ACS) in the Higher Education Department since December 1, 2024, he has held various key positions including Additional Chief Secretary, Ex-Officio Principal Secretary, Chief Electoral Officer, Commissioner, Managing Director, Additional Secretary, Director, Secretary, District Collector, CEO, Sub-Divisional Officer, and Assistant Collector. He is proficient in English and Hindi and continues to serve in the Indian Administrative Service.
